what4-1.1: Solver-agnostic symbolic values support for issuing queries

Index - A

abcOptionsWhat4.Solver.ExternalABC, What4.Solver
abcPathWhat4.Solver.ExternalABC, What4.Solver
absWhat4.Protocol.SMTLib2.Syntax
absAndWhat4.Utils.AbstractDomains
absOrWhat4.Utils.AbstractDomains
AbstractableWhat4.Utils.AbstractDomains
abstractEvalWhat4.Expr.App
AbstractValueWhat4.Utils.AbstractDomains
AbstractValueWrapper 
1 (Type/Class)What4.Utils.AbstractDomains
2 (Data Constructor)What4.Utils.AbstractDomains
AckActionWhat4.Protocol.SMTWriter
AcknowledgementActionWhat4.Protocol.SMTWriter
add 
1 (Function)What4.Protocol.SMTLib2.Syntax
2 (Function)What4.SemiRing
3 (Function)What4.Utils.BVDomain.Arith
4 (Function)What4.Utils.BVDomain
5 (Function)What4.Expr.WeightedSum
6 (Function)What4.Expr.UnaryBV
addCommandWhat4.Protocol.SMTWriter, What4.Solver.Yices
addCommandNoAckWhat4.Protocol.SMTWriter
addCommandsWhat4.Protocol.SMTWriter
addConditionWhat4.Partial
addConstantWhat4.Expr.WeightedSum
addFreshInputWhat4.Protocol.VerilogWriter.AST
addFreshWireWhat4.Protocol.VerilogWriter.AST
addIsLeqWhat4.BaseTypes, What4.Interface
addIsLeqLeft1What4.BaseTypes, What4.Interface
addMulDistribRightWhat4.BaseTypes, What4.Interface
addNatWhat4.BaseTypes, What4.Interface
addOutputWhat4.Protocol.VerilogWriter.AST
addPrefixIsLeqWhat4.BaseTypes, What4.Interface
addRangeWhat4.Utils.AbstractDomains
addSignedOFWhat4.Interface
addUnsignedOFWhat4.Interface
addVar 
1 (Function)What4.Expr.BoolMap
2 (Function)What4.Expr.WeightedSum
addVarsWhat4.Expr.WeightedSum
addWireWhat4.Protocol.VerilogWriter.AST
allSupportedWhat4.Protocol.SMTLib2.Syntax, What4.Protocol.SMTLib2
allTrueEntriesWhat4.Interface
all_supportedWhat4.Protocol.SMTLib2
alterWhat4.Utils.AnnotatedMap
alterFWhat4.Utils.AnnotatedMap
AlwaysUnfoldWhat4.Interface
AndWhat4.Protocol.VerilogWriter.AST
and 
1 (Function)What4.Protocol.SMTLib2.Syntax
2 (Function)What4.Utils.BVDomain.Bitwise
3 (Function)What4.Utils.BVDomain.XOR
4 (Function)What4.Utils.BVDomain
andAllWhat4.Protocol.SMTWriter
andAllOfWhat4.Interface
andPredWhat4.Interface
and_scalarWhat4.Utils.BVDomain.XOR
AnnotatedMapWhat4.Utils.AnnotatedMap
annotateTermWhat4.Interface
AnnotationWhat4.Expr.App, What4.Expr.Builder, What4.Expr
annotationWhat4.Utils.AnnotatedMap
AnOnlineSolver 
1 (Type/Class)What4.Protocol.Online
2 (Data Constructor)What4.Protocol.Online
any 
1 (Function)What4.Utils.BVDomain.Arith
2 (Function)What4.Utils.BVDomain.Bitwise
3 (Function)What4.Utils.BVDomain
APEWhat4.Expr.App
apeDocWhat4.Expr.App
apeExprsWhat4.Expr.App
apeIndexWhat4.Expr.App
apeLengthWhat4.Expr.App
apeLocWhat4.Expr.App
apeNameWhat4.Expr.App
AppWhat4.Expr.App, What4.Expr.Builder, What4.Expr
appWhat4.Protocol.SMTWriter
append 
1 (Function)What4.Utils.Word16String
2 (Function)What4.Expr.StringSeq
appEqFWhat4.Expr.App
AppExpr 
1 (Data Constructor)What4.Expr.App, What4.Expr.Builder, What4.Expr
2 (Type/Class)What4.Expr.App, What4.Expr.Builder, What4.Expr
appExprAbsValueWhat4.Expr.App
appExprAppWhat4.Expr.App, What4.Expr.Builder, What4.Expr
AppExprCtorWhat4.Expr.App
appExprIdWhat4.Expr.App, What4.Expr.Builder, What4.Expr
appExprLocWhat4.Expr.App, What4.Expr.Builder, What4.Expr
applySymFnWhat4.Interface
AppPPExpr 
1 (Data Constructor)What4.Expr.App
2 (Type/Class)What4.Expr.App
approximateWhat4.Protocol.PolyRoot
AppTheoryWhat4.Expr.AppTheory, What4.Expr
appTheoryWhat4.Expr.AppTheory, What4.Expr
appTypeWhat4.Expr.App, What4.Expr.Builder
app_listWhat4.Protocol.SMTWriter
arithDomainDataWhat4.Utils.BVDomain.Arith, What4.Utils.BVDomain
arithToXorDomainWhat4.Utils.BVDomain
ArrayWhat4.Protocol.SMTLib2.Parse
ArrayConcreteWhat4.Expr.GroundEval, What4.Expr
arrayConst 
1 (Function)What4.Protocol.SMTLib2.Syntax
2 (Function)What4.Protocol.SMTLib2
arrayConstantWhat4.Protocol.SMTWriter
ArrayConstantFnWhat4.Protocol.SMTWriter
arrayEqWhat4.Interface
ArrayFromFnWhat4.Expr.App, What4.Expr.Builder, What4.Expr
arrayFromFnWhat4.Interface
arrayFromMapWhat4.Interface
arrayIteWhat4.Interface
arrayLookupWhat4.Interface
ArrayMapWhat4.Expr.App, What4.Expr.Builder, What4.Expr
arrayMapWhat4.Interface
ArrayMappingWhat4.Expr.GroundEval, What4.Expr
ArrayResultWrapper 
1 (Type/Class)What4.Interface, What4.Expr.Builder
2 (Data Constructor)What4.Interface, What4.Expr.Builder
arraySelect 
1 (Function)What4.Protocol.SMTWriter
2 (Function)What4.Protocol.SMTLib2
arraySortWhat4.Protocol.SMTLib2.Syntax, What4.Protocol.SMTLib2
arrayStoreWhat4.Protocol.SMTLib2
ArrayTheoryWhat4.Expr.AppTheory, What4.Expr
ArrayTrueOnEntriesWhat4.Expr.App, What4.Expr.Builder, What4.Expr
arrayTrueOnEntriesWhat4.Interface
arrayTypeIndicesWhat4.BaseTypes, What4.Interface
arrayTypeResultWhat4.BaseTypes, What4.Interface
arrayUpdate 
1 (Function)What4.Interface
2 (Function)What4.Protocol.SMTWriter
arrayUpdateAbsWhat4.Expr.ArrayUpdateMap
arrayUpdateAtIdxLitsWhat4.Interface
ArrayUpdateMapWhat4.Expr.ArrayUpdateMap
asAffineVar 
1 (Function)What4.Expr.WeightedSum
2 (Function)What4.Interface
asAppWhat4.Expr.App, What4.Expr.Builder
asArithDomainWhat4.Utils.BVDomain
asAtomListWhat4.Protocol.SExp
asBitwiseDomainWhat4.Utils.BVDomain
asBVWhat4.Interface
asComplexWhat4.Interface
asConcreteWhat4.Interface
asConjunctionWhat4.Expr.App, What4.Expr.Builder
AsConstWhat4.Protocol.SMTLib2.Parse
asConstant 
1 (Function)What4.Expr.WeightedSum
2 (Function)What4.Expr.UnaryBV
asConstantArrayWhat4.Interface
asConstantPredWhat4.Interface
asDisjunctionWhat4.Expr.App, What4.Expr.Builder
asFloatWhat4.Interface
ashr 
1 (Function)What4.Utils.BVDomain.Arith
2 (Function)What4.Utils.BVDomain.Bitwise
3 (Function)What4.Utils.BVDomain
asIntegerWhat4.Interface
asMatlabSolverFnWhat4.Expr.App
asNatWhat4.Interface
asNegAtomWhat4.Expr.App
asNegAtomListWhat4.Protocol.SExp
asNonceAppWhat4.Expr.App, What4.Expr.Builder
asPosAtomWhat4.Expr.App
asProdVarWhat4.Expr.WeightedSum
asRationalWhat4.Interface
asSemiRingLitWhat4.Expr.App
asSemiRingProdWhat4.Expr.App
asSemiRingSumWhat4.Expr.App
assertWhat4.Protocol.SMTLib2.Syntax
assertCommandWhat4.Protocol.SMTWriter
assertForallWhat4.Solver.Yices
assertNamedWhat4.Protocol.SMTLib2.Syntax
assertNamedCommandWhat4.Protocol.SMTWriter
AssignWhat4.Protocol.VerilogWriter.AST
asSingleRangeWhat4.Utils.AbstractDomains
asSingleton 
1 (Function)What4.Utils.BVDomain.Arith
2 (Function)What4.Utils.BVDomain.Bitwise
3 (Function)What4.Utils.BVDomain.XOR
4 (Function)What4.Utils.BVDomain
asSMT2TypeWhat4.Protocol.SMTLib2
asStringWhat4.Interface
asStructWhat4.Interface
assumeWhat4.Protocol.SMTWriter, What4.Protocol.SMTLib2, What4.Solver.Yices
assumedPropTest.Verification
assumeFormulaWhat4.Protocol.SMTWriter
assumeFormulaWithFreshNameWhat4.Protocol.SMTWriter
assumeFormulaWithNameWhat4.Protocol.SMTWriter
AssumingTest.Verification
assumingTest.Verification
AssumptionTest.Verification
AssumptionPropTest.Verification
asVarWhat4.Expr.WeightedSum
asWeightedSumWhat4.Expr.App
asWeightedVarWhat4.Expr.WeightedSum
asXorDomainWhat4.Utils.BVDomain
avCheckEqWhat4.Utils.AbstractDomains
avContainsWhat4.Utils.AbstractDomains
avJoinWhat4.Utils.AbstractDomains
avOverlapWhat4.Utils.AbstractDomains
avSingleWhat4.Utils.AbstractDomains
avTopWhat4.Utils.AbstractDomains